What are the typical working conditions and schedules for employees at Marine Atlantic?

Employees at Marine Atlantic often work shifts that accommodate the round-the-clock nature of ferry operations, which may include nights, weekends, and holidays. Depending on the role, staff may spend significant time onboard vessels, in port facilities, or working outdoors in varying weather conditions. Teamwork is essential, as daily tasks require close collaboration between departments such as engineering, hospitality, and deck crew members. Flexibility and adaptability are important, as priorities can shift quickly based on passenger needs and operational requirements. This variety creates a dynamic work environment that many employees find rewarding and engaging.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Marine Atlantic position?

To thrive at Marine Atlantic, professionals typically need experience in maritime operations, safety procedures, and customer service, with relevant certifications such as Marine Emergency Duties (MED) or a Transport Canada Certificate depending on the position. Familiarity with onboard safety systems, navigational tools, ticketing software, and vessel management systems is often required. Flexibility, strong teamwork, and excellent communication skills help employees excel in dynamic, passenger-focused environments. These skills ensure smooth operations, passenger safety, and high-quality service in a fast-paced marine transportation setting.

What is a Marine Atlantic?

A Marine Atlantic job refers to a position with Marine Atlantic, a Canadian Crown corporation that operates ferry services between Newfoundland and Nova Scotia. These jobs include roles in vessel operations, maintenance, customer service, administration, and more. Employees work in a dynamic, maritime environment, ensuring safe and efficient travel for passengers and freight. Marine Atlantic offers competitive salaries, benefits, and career growth opportunities.
